Commit 9371f7ab by Jamie Madill Committed by Commit Bot

D3D11: Remove unsized formats from the table.

These cases weren't actually ever hit within ANGLE. BUG=angleproject:1455 Change-Id: I60da3fb9eae91598ddaed5572a4bab0a66345694 Reviewed-on: https://chromium-review.googlesource.com/367691Reviewed-by: 's avatarGeoff Lang <geofflang@chromium.org> Commit-Queue: Jamie Madill <jmadill@chromium.org>
parent 30712068
{ {
"GL_ALPHA": "A8_UNORM",
"GL_ALPHA16F_EXT": "R16G16B16A16_FLOAT", "GL_ALPHA16F_EXT": "R16G16B16A16_FLOAT",
"GL_ALPHA32F_EXT": "R32G32B32A32_FLOAT", "GL_ALPHA32F_EXT": "R32G32B32A32_FLOAT",
"GL_ALPHA8_EXT": "A8_UNORM", "GL_ALPHA8_EXT": "A8_UNORM",
...@@ -58,12 +57,10 @@ ...@@ -58,12 +57,10 @@
"GL_DEPTH_COMPONENT32_OES": "D24_UNORM_S8_UINT", "GL_DEPTH_COMPONENT32_OES": "D24_UNORM_S8_UINT",
"GL_ETC1_RGB8_OES": "R8G8B8A8_UNORM", "GL_ETC1_RGB8_OES": "R8G8B8A8_UNORM",
"GL_ETC1_RGB8_LOSSY_DECODE_ANGLE": "BC1_UNORM", "GL_ETC1_RGB8_LOSSY_DECODE_ANGLE": "BC1_UNORM",
"GL_LUMINANCE": "R8G8B8A8_UNORM",
"GL_LUMINANCE16F_EXT": "R16G16B16A16_FLOAT", "GL_LUMINANCE16F_EXT": "R16G16B16A16_FLOAT",
"GL_LUMINANCE32F_EXT": "R32G32B32A32_FLOAT", "GL_LUMINANCE32F_EXT": "R32G32B32A32_FLOAT",
"GL_LUMINANCE8_ALPHA8_EXT": "R8G8B8A8_UNORM", "GL_LUMINANCE8_ALPHA8_EXT": "R8G8B8A8_UNORM",
"GL_LUMINANCE8_EXT": "R8G8B8A8_UNORM", "GL_LUMINANCE8_EXT": "R8G8B8A8_UNORM",
"GL_LUMINANCE_ALPHA": "R8G8B8A8_UNORM",
"GL_LUMINANCE_ALPHA16F_EXT": "R16G16B16A16_FLOAT", "GL_LUMINANCE_ALPHA16F_EXT": "R16G16B16A16_FLOAT",
"GL_LUMINANCE_ALPHA32F_EXT": "R32G32B32A32_FLOAT", "GL_LUMINANCE_ALPHA32F_EXT": "R32G32B32A32_FLOAT",
"GL_NONE": "NONE", "GL_NONE": "NONE",
......
...@@ -34,37 +34,6 @@ const Format &Format::Get(GLenum internalFormat, ...@@ -34,37 +34,6 @@ const Format &Format::Get(GLenum internalFormat,
// clang-format off // clang-format off
switch (internalFormat) switch (internalFormat)
{ {
case GL_ALPHA:
{
if (OnlyFL10Plus(deviceCaps))
{
static const Format info(GL_ALPHA,
angle::Format::ID::A8_UNORM,
DXGI_FORMAT_A8_UNORM,
DXGI_FORMAT_A8_UNORM,
DXGI_FORMAT_A8_UNORM,
DXGI_FORMAT_UNKNOWN,
DXGI_FORMAT_A8_UNORM,
GL_RGBA8,
nullptr,
deviceCaps);
return info;
}
else
{
static const Format info(GL_ALPHA,
angle::Format::ID::R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_UNKNOWN,
DXGI_FORMAT_R8G8B8A8_UNORM,
GL_RGBA8,
nullptr,
deviceCaps);
return info;
}
}
case GL_ALPHA16F_EXT: case GL_ALPHA16F_EXT:
{ {
static const Format info(GL_ALPHA16F_EXT, static const Format info(GL_ALPHA16F_EXT,
...@@ -979,20 +948,6 @@ const Format &Format::Get(GLenum internalFormat, ...@@ -979,20 +948,6 @@ const Format &Format::Get(GLenum internalFormat,
deviceCaps); deviceCaps);
return info; return info;
} }
case GL_LUMINANCE:
{
static const Format info(GL_LUMINANCE,
angle::Format::ID::R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_UNKNOWN,
DXGI_FORMAT_R8G8B8A8_UNORM,
GL_RGBA8,
Initialize4ComponentData<GLubyte, 0x00, 0x00, 0x00, 0xFF>,
deviceCaps);
return info;
}
case GL_LUMINANCE16F_EXT: case GL_LUMINANCE16F_EXT:
{ {
static const Format info(GL_LUMINANCE16F_EXT, static const Format info(GL_LUMINANCE16F_EXT,
...@@ -1049,20 +1004,6 @@ const Format &Format::Get(GLenum internalFormat, ...@@ -1049,20 +1004,6 @@ const Format &Format::Get(GLenum internalFormat,
deviceCaps); deviceCaps);
return info; return info;
} }
case GL_LUMINANCE_ALPHA:
{
static const Format info(GL_LUMINANCE_ALPHA,
angle::Format::ID::R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_R8G8B8A8_UNORM,
DXGI_FORMAT_UNKNOWN,
DXGI_FORMAT_R8G8B8A8_UNORM,
GL_RGBA8,
nullptr,
deviceCaps);
return info;
}
case GL_LUMINANCE_ALPHA16F_EXT: case GL_LUMINANCE_ALPHA16F_EXT:
{ {
static const Format info(GL_LUMINANCE_ALPHA16F_EXT, static const Format info(GL_LUMINANCE_ALPHA16F_EXT,
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ment